Hi,
I have a Thinkpad Lenovo X1 Carbon 3rd generation.
Few month ago an official technician replace the screen panel and the motherboard.
Then I gave the X1 to my daughter.
Now the X1 has a problem : the bios date is automatically reset to 01/01/2001 after some hours without using it, it wont start without the AC adaptor.
So I thought it is a CMOS battery issue and I start to open the X1 in order to replace it.
I saw a guy on a youtube video open the X1 2nd generation and I saw the CMOS battery on the rear side of the motherboard.
So I opened my X1, removed all elements in order to access and removed the MB. When I look at his back...no CMOS battery ! There is the location for the battery, there is the connector for the battery but nothing !!!
Do you know where is this CMOS battery ???
Thanks !

Re: No CMOS battery !
Welcome to the Forum.
It is missing.
The X1C3 has a CR1632 CMOS battery with black plastic cover, it plugs into the black connector top-left.
See the last picture here: https://www.ebay.com/itm/132423093198
But AFAIK any other (yellow) CR1632 CMOS battery will also fit (the usual CR2032 is probably too big)

Re: No CMOS battery !
Those CMOS batteries are a bit confusing.
I just opened my own X1 Carbon Gen1, it has a CR1632 # 45N5864.
CR2032: 20mm diameter, 3.2mm thick (usual ones)
CR1632: 16mm diameter, 3.2mm thick (e.g. X1C1)
As used in ThinkPads, both have the same cable connector: 3mm wide, 2mm thick
CR1620: 16mm diameter, 2.0mm thick (e.g. X1C3, yours)
I'm surprised if that connector would be smaller than usual.
Maybe that shop gave you a CMOS with a bigger-than-normal connector?
Can you measure the inside of your CMOS connector on the motherboard?

Re: No CMOS battery !
I received a new battery with cable and connector !
When I look at the one I bought first time this is definetely NOT the same connector...
The last one fit perfectly on the motherboard, I installed it in 3 seconds !
Issue resolved !
Thanx for your advice
PS: the reference of this battery is 00HN933 and it's a CR1620 for Yoga X1 (wrote on the package)
